博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
Java 获取当前线程、进程、服务器ip
阅读量:4614 次
发布时间:2019-06-09

本文共 783 字,大约阅读时间需要 2 分钟。

/** * 获取当前线程id */private Long getThreadId() {    try {        return Thread.currentThread().getId();    } catch (Exception e) {        return null;    }}/** * 获取当前进程id */private Long getProcessId() {    try {        RuntimeMXBean runtime = ManagementFactory.getRuntimeMXBean();        String name = runtime.getName();        String pid = name.substring(0, name.indexOf('@' ));        return Long.parseLong(pid);    } catch (Exception e) {        return null;    }}/** * 获取当前服务器ip地址 */private String getServerIp() {    try {        //用 getLocalHost() 方法创建的InetAddress的对象        InetAddress address = InetAddress.getLocalHost();        return address.getHostAddress();    } catch (Exception e) {        return null;    }}

 

转载于:https://www.cnblogs.com/acm-bingzi/p/thread_process_ip.html

你可能感兴趣的文章
兼容性
查看>>
自动执行sftp命令的脚本
查看>>
转 Merkle Tree(默克尔树)算法解析
查看>>
网络编程基础之socket编程
查看>>
[转] 利用shell创建文本菜单与窗口部件的方法
查看>>
各种浏览器的user-agent和
查看>>
Restful levels
查看>>
Phonegap移动开发:布局总结(一) 全局
查看>>
Java 变参函数的实现
查看>>
Spring重温(四)--Spring自动组件扫描
查看>>
Android设计图(标注、切图)
查看>>
strstr and strpos
查看>>
hash算法与拉链法解决冲突
查看>>
如何使用jQuery判断一个元素是否存在
查看>>
HTML5中的Canvas(颜色)【转载】
查看>>
420. Strong Password Checker
查看>>
用字节流添加内容至txt中
查看>>
手写算式的识别与运算
查看>>
jquery 1.9 1.8 判断 浏览器(IE11,IE8,IE7,IE6)版本
查看>>
Reporting Services 的一些问题
查看>>